Datebook for May 14, 2004
Friday, May 14, 2004 | 8:18 a.m.
Unity Festival
The city of Las Vegas Department of Leisure Services will sponsor the 12th annual Unity Festival from 11 a.m. to 2 p.m. Saturday at the Doolittle Community Center, 1950 N. J St. Admission is free. 229-6374.
Fun run/walk
The Candlelighters will host a 5K and 1-Mile Fun Run/Walk beginning at 6:30 a.m. Saturday at Paseo Verde Park, 1851 Paseo Verde Parkway. To register, call 737-1919 or go online at www.active.com.
Reggae Festival
The Cannery Casino & Hotel will host the "One Love Reggae Fest" on Saturday and Sunday. Admission is $20 or $15 in advance, and activities include an international food and craft fair and musical acts. 617-5550 or www.showtickets.com.

Day of Adventure
Bring the family downtown for a day of adventure from 10 a.m. to 3 p.m. Saturday. Admission is free for the Lied Discovery Children's Museum, Las Vegas Natural History Museum, Old Las Vegas Mormon Fort State Park, Reed Whipple Cultural Center, Neon Museum and Las Vegas Library. 229-1237.
Acting classes
Clark County Parks & Community Services is offering free acting classes from 1 p.m. to 3 p.m. every Wednesday at Whitney Center, 5712 E. Missouri Ave. Pre-registration is requested. 455-7576.
